COLLEGE OF AGRICULTURE, Ayodhya is a constituent college of the state agricultural Acharya Narendra Deva University of Agriculture and Technology, located in Kumarganj, Ayodhya. Established with 20 departments in 1977, it is a key institution for agricultural education in the region. Focused on academic strength in agriculture and allied sciences, the college contributes significantly to the university's repute, which holds a NAAC A++ accreditation.

What is General at College of Agriculture Ayodhya?

This B.F.Sc program at College of Agriculture, Ayodhya, affiliated with Acharya Narendra Deva University of Agriculture and Technology, focuses on the holistic study of fisheries science, encompassing aquaculture, capture fisheries, fish processing, and aquatic environment management. The curriculum is designed to equip students with the scientific knowledge and practical skills essential for sustainable development of the fisheries sector in India, addressing both inland and marine aquatic resources.

Who Should Apply?

This program is ideal for 10+2 science stream graduates with a keen interest in aquatic life, marine biology, sustainable resource management, and contributing to the blue revolution in India. It also suits individuals passionate about scientific research, entrepreneurship in aquaculture, and those seeking to address food security challenges through innovative fisheries practices.

Why Choose This Course?

Graduates of this program can expect diverse career paths in India, including roles in state fisheries departments, central government organizations like ICAR institutes, research bodies, private aquaculture farms, feed industries, fish processing units, and entrepreneurship. Entry-level salaries typically range from INR 3-6 lakhs per annum, with significant growth potential in specialized and leadership roles within the rapidly expanding Indian fisheries sector.

Program Structure and Curriculum

Eligibility:

  • 10+2 with Physics, Chemistry, Biology/Agriculture/Home Science (with Maths as a preferred additional subject in some cases) with minimum 50% marks (40% for SC/ST/PwD) from a recognized board.

Duration: 8 semesters (4 years)

Credits: 167 Credits
